Canelas ( port. Canelas ) is a locality and district in Portugal , part of the Porto district. It is an integral part of the municipality of Vila Nova de Gaia . It is part of a large metropolitan area of Greater Porto . According to the old administrative division, it was part of the province of Douro-Litoral . Included in the economic and statistical subregion of Greater Porto , which is part of the Northern region . The population is 12,303 people in 2001 . Covers an area of 7.47 km².
